“Rate at Which Girls Are Spending Time On Social Network is Worrisome” – Sultan of Sokoto

Speaking at the 6th National Edition of the Quranic Recitation Competition, Sultan of Sokoto, Saad Abubakar, expressed how worried he was at the rate social media is keeping youths especially girls from their studies.

According to him, if girls who are nerve center of our moral and societal development derail, the whole society will be in danger because they are our mothers and care givers.

“There is a disturbing development where the attention of students is being diverted from their studies. This is through the use of various social media like Facebook, Twitter, Whatsapp, 2Go and Instagram, among others.

“The rate at which girls are spending time on social network is worrisome and this poses imminent danger to our society. Girls are the nerve centre of our moral and societal development and if they derail, the whole society will be in danger because they are our mothers and care givers” the sultan said

The traditional ruler urged youth, particularly girls, to stop spending too much time on social media at the expense of other engagements that would add more values to their life.

Mr. Abubakar advised parents to ensure that their daughters spend more time on meaningful things, like reciting the Holy Qur’an. “Doing so will make them better mothers and care givers’’
